Today, our 6th grade students spent an engaging and meaningful day at the Leelanau Outdoor Center, participating in hands-on activities that connected directly to what they are learning in school. Through outdoor exploration, teamwork, and guided activities, students applied classroom concepts to real-world situations, helping deepen their understanding and make learning more relevant.

Students worked collaboratively to problem-solve, observe nature, and think critically while having a ton of fun. The experience encouraged curiosity, communication, and perseverance while reinforcing academic skills and fostering connections between learning and the outside world.

In addition to academic connections, the day supported social-emotional growth as students practiced teamwork, responsibility, and self-management in a new setting. Overall, it was a valuable experience that allowed students to learn, reflect, and grow beyond the classroom walls.

And this is just Part One! In the Spring they will travel back to Leelanau Outdoor Center for 3 days and 2 nights of educational fun! Parents we will be reaching out for night time chaperones! Glen Lake Middle School students in our Community Connections class spent the afternoon giving back in meaningful ways. Our 7th graders have been actively engaged in service learning, and today they volunteered several hours at Leelanau Christian Neighbors, helping set up their incredible Holiday Needs Gift-Giving Exchange.

Just last week, the same group donated their time and energy to 5 Loaves 2 Fish, a local organization that prepares meals for individuals and families in our community experiencing hunger and homelessness.

These experiences are true game changers for our students. They go beyond learning about service—students are living it. This is service learning at its best: building empathy, connection, and a deeper understanding of the impact they can have on the world around them.
